2. Compatibility
This ProCase Wireless Keyboard Case is specifically designed for the following iPad models:
- iPad 11th Generation (A16) 11-inch 2025 (Model Numbers: A3355, A3356, A3354)
- iPad 10th Generation 10.9-inch 2022 (Model Numbers: A2696, A2757, A2777)
To confirm compatibility, please check the model number located on the back bottom of your iPad. This case is not compatible with iPad Air 11-inch (M2) 2024 or iPad Air 5th & 4th Gen 10.9-inch models.

4. Product Features
The ProCase Wireless Keyboard Case offers several features designed for convenience and protection:
- Magnetically Detachable Wireless Keyboard: The keyboard can be easily attached or removed from the case, allowing for flexible use.
- Adjustable Viewing Angles: The case features three distinct grooves to prop up your iPad at different angles for comfortable viewing and typing in landscape mode.
- Premium Protection: Constructed from durable PU leather, the exterior safeguards your iPad from drops and impacts, while a soft anti-slip interior prevents scratches.
- Built-in Pencil Holder: A dedicated slot keeps your Apple Pencil secure and accessible.
- Auto Sleep/Wake Function: When the keyboard is detached, closing the case will automatically put your iPad to sleep, and opening it will wake it up.
- Precise Cutouts: Ensures full access to all ports, buttons, and camera functions without removing the case.

5. Setup
5.1 Charging the Keyboard
Before initial use, ensure the wireless keyboard is fully charged. Connect the provided charging cable to the keyboard's charging port and a USB power source. The charging indicator light will illuminate during charging and turn off when complete.
5.2 Inserting Your iPad into the Case
- Gently align your iPad with the case's frame.
- Press the iPad firmly into the case, ensuring all edges are securely seated.
- Verify that all ports, buttons, and the camera are accessible through the case's cutouts.
6. Operating Instructions
6.1 Pairing the Wireless Keyboard with Your iPad
Follow these steps to connect your ProCase wireless keyboard to your iPad via Bluetooth:
- Locate the power switch on the keyboard. Slide the power button to the ON position. A blue status light will briefly illuminate and then turn off.
- Press the Connect button on the keyboard. The blue indicator light will begin to blink, indicating it is in pairing mode.
- On your iPad, navigate to Settings > Bluetooth and ensure Bluetooth is enabled.
- The wireless keyboard will appear in the list of available devices (e.g., "Bluetooth Keyboard"). Select it.
- If prompted, enter the displayed code on the keyboard and press Enter.
- Once your iPad is successfully connected, the blue indicator light on the keyboard will turn off.

6.2 Using the Adjustable Stand
The case features three grooves to create a stable stand for your iPad. Simply fold the front cover back and align the bottom edge of your iPad with one of the grooves to achieve your desired viewing angle in landscape mode.
6.3 Auto Sleep/Wake Function
The auto sleep/wake function operates when the keyboard is not attached to the case. Closing the case cover will automatically put your iPad to sleep, conserving battery life. Opening the cover will wake your iPad.
7. Maintenance
- Cleaning the Case: Wipe the exterior of the case with a soft, damp cloth.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
- Cleaning the Keyboard: Use a soft, dry cloth to clean the keyboard. For stubborn dirt, a slightly damp cloth can be used, ensuring no moisture enters the keys or ports.
- Storage: When not in use for extended periods, store the case and keyboard in a cool, dry place. Ensure the keyboard is turned off to preserve battery life.
- Avoid Extreme Conditions: Do not expose the product to extreme temperatures, direct sunlight, or excessive moisture.
8.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Keyboard does not turn on. | Low battery. | Charge the keyboard for at least 2-3 hours. |
| Keyboard does not connect to iPad. | Bluetooth is off on iPad. Keyboard not in pairing mode. Interference. | Ensure Bluetooth is enabled on your iPad. Follow pairing steps (Section 6.1). Move closer to the iPad and away from other wireless devices. |
| Keys are not responding. | Keyboard is disconnected or low battery. | Reconnect the keyboard via Bluetooth. Charge the keyboard. |
| Auto Sleep/Wake not working. | Keyboard is attached to the case. | The auto sleep/wake function only works when the keyboard is detached from the case. |
